    Based on my knowledge Yahoo now wants you to use OAuth for Outlook, not those app passwords anymore.

    If you have an old version of Outlook or your IMAP settings are wrong, it might not sync.

    Heads up: Outlook.com doesn't sync other email accounts directly anymore.

    Here’s how to fix it.

    Add Yahoo with OAuth (no app password needed):

    In Outlook, click File > Add Account.

    Type in your Yahoo email and hit Connect.

    A Yahoo login box will pop up—put in your regular password and do the two-step thing if you have it.

    When it asks, click Agree to allow access.

    This works if your Outlook is up to date (Current Channel or newer).

    Update Outlook to the newest version.
